## Rate Limiting — Gateway Release Notes (Pillarmesh)

New folks: the internal API gateway enforces per-service rate limits defined in `limits.yaml`. Each release must bump the config version, or the gateway silently keeps stale limits. After editing, run the validator, then redeploy the gateway pods in the staging ring first and watch the throttle dashboards for ten minutes. Production rollout requires the limits bundle to be signed before the deployer will accept it. Sign the bundle with the key below.

deploy key for kajof-fajop: bky6_gDHw9Q

## Further Reading

Encoding detection in Texthopper is mostly handled by the Glyphsense module, but it's worth understanding why we sniff byte-order marks before falling back to statistical guessing. Misdetected Latin-1 uploads are our most common support ticket. For the full design notes and known edge cases, see the internal wiki page here:

runbook for kawef-hahif: https://jira.lumicsys.internal/projects/browse/display/c08d703c

## Deployment — BranchPoint assignment service

BranchPoint serves experiment-arm assignments over gRPC. Plugin authors: your bucketing plugins load at startup only; hot reload is not supported. Deploy as a single stateless container per region behind the Larkmoor gateway, with the assignment store reachable before boot or the process exits. Plugins failing validation are skipped, not fatal — check startup logs. Each instance reads its settings from the environment; a reference configuration follows below.

config for kawif-hahig:
zorix:
  log_level: error
  metrics_host: metrics.zorix.lumiclabs.internal
  pool_size: 16